Common Core Top Pick for Reading Literature and Informational Text Key Ideas and Details Integration of Knowledge and Ideas Range of Reading and level of Text Complexity View all Common Core Top Picks for Reading Literature and Informational Text History Pockets-Life in Plymouth Colony, Grades 1–3, contains eight discovery pockets. Each of the pockets contains: a reproducible pocket label four dictionary words and pictures a fact sheet of background information for the teacher a reproducible student information booklet complete with illustrations arts and crafts projects, plus writing activities Evaluation forms are provided at the end of the book to give students a chance to reflect on all they have learned. The eight pockets about Pilgrims and their way of life are: Voyage to the New World The New World Building a Village Home Sweet Home The Family Working in Plymouth Colony Going to School What Did the Pilgrims Give Us? This resource contains teacher support pages, reproducible student pages, and an answer key.
